Challenges and Trends
In industries such as power generation and aerospace, opportunities to handle difficult-to-machine materials like stainless steel and heat-resistant alloys are increasing. While these materials excel in high-temperature strength and corrosion resistance, they present challenges due to high cutting resistance, leading to short tool life. Furthermore, as workpiece geometries become more complex, machining with long overhangs is often required to access recessed areas and avoid interference with fixtures. Under such conditions, tool deflection easily causes chatter, leading to productivity losses. The market demand for tools capable of achieving long tool life and stable, high-efficiency machining is growing significantly.

Benefits and Features
Feature 1: Extended Tool Life via Low Cutting Angle
– The UER insert’s low cutting angle design generates thin chips, achieving extended tool life. Particularly effective for machining difficult-to-cut materials like stainless steel and heat-resistant alloys.
Feature 2: High Stability During Long Overhang Machining
-Using UER inserts reduces chatter even under long overhang conditions, enabling expanded machining capabilities and improved productivity.
